H3: Visit Gwanghwamun Square

Start your arts exploration in Seoul by visiting Gwanghwamun Square, a historic public space that serves as the gateway to Gyeongbokgung Palace. Here, you’ll find a collection of public art installations, including statues of important historical figures and symbolic sculptures that reflect Korea’s cultural heritage. Take a leisurely stroll through the square and immerse yourself in the beauty of these artistic creations while learning about Korea’s fascinating past.

H3: Explore Insadong

For a more contemporary arts experience, head to Insadong, a vibrant neighborhood in Seoul that is known for its art galleries, traditional tea houses, and handicraft shops. Explore the narrow alleyways of Insadong and discover a treasure trove of artistic delights, from modern paintings and sculptures to intricate ceramics and calligraphy. H3: Visit the National Museum of Modern and Contemporary Art

Art lovers will definitely want to make a stop at the National Museum of Modern and Contemporary Art (MMCA) in Seoul. This world-class museum houses an impressive collection of modern and contemporary Korean art, featuring works by renowned artists as well as up-and-coming talents. Explore the museum’s galleries and appreciate the diverse range of artistic styles and movements that have shaped Korea’s art scene over the years.

H3: Take a Street Art Tour in Hongdae

If you’re a fan of street art, be sure to visit Hongdae, a youthful and artsy district in Seoul that is famous for its vibrant street art scene. Join a guided street art tour and explore the colorful murals and graffiti that adorn the walls of Hongdae’s streets and alleys. Engage with local artists, learn about their creative process, and gain a deeper appreciation for the urban art culture of Seoul.
